Transaction 73a813268706441c9df8f61f22f670963acc01206ab487de01109e32b1c522fb
1 Input
1 Output
-
73a813268706441c9df8f61f22f670963acc01206ab487de01109e32b1c522fb:0
- value
- 562710
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c4f3f8583fb949af6fdab1de6029a05cc97e145 OP_EQUAL
- address
- 3MmuX18kjJC8JCwrYBDwjh7pr5ZimMqujH